Working Principles

The MS46SR-20-610-Q2-15X-15R-NC-FP operates based on the principle of time-of-flight measurement using infrared light. It emits a modulated infrared beam and measures the time it takes for the beam to be reflected back, allowing it to calculate the distance to the target object accurately.
